|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Inventory (stock)
• Invoicing (account) • Purchase (purchase) • Discuss (mail) |
| Lines of code | 808 |
| Technical Name |
leeno_direct_print |
| License | LGPL-3 |
| Website | https://www.leenconsult.com |
| Availability |
Odoo Online
Odoo.sh
On Premise
|
| Odoo Apps Dependencies |
•
Inventory (stock)
• Invoicing (account) • Purchase (purchase) • Discuss (mail) |
| Lines of code | 808 |
| Technical Name |
leeno_direct_print |
| License | LGPL-3 |
| Website | https://www.leenconsult.com |
Direct Print
Print documents and product labels directly from your browser â no extra software needed.
Key Features
- Browser Print Dialog â Opens your operating system's native print dialog so you can select any local, network, or virtual printer (PDF, etc.).
- Product Label Printing â Print product labels in multiple formats (Dymo, 2Ã7, 4Ã7, 4Ã12) with or without prices, directly from products, sales orders, purchase orders, invoices, and stock transfers.
- Direct Print for Any Report â Enable the "Use Direct Print" toggle on any Odoo report to make it open the browser print dialog instead of downloading a PDF.
- Gear Menu Integration â "Direct Print" appears in the action/gear menu on Contacts, Sales Orders, Purchase Orders, Invoices, and Stock Transfers.
- Header Buttons â Quick-access print buttons in the form header of key documents.
- No External Dependencies â Works entirely in the browser. No printer agents, browser extensions, or Java applets required.
Supported Documents
| Document | Direct Print | Label Printing |
|---|---|---|
| Contacts | â | |
| Products | â | |
| Sales Orders | â | â |
| Purchase Orders | â | â |
| Invoices / Bills | â | â |
| Stock Transfers | â | â |
How It Works
- Install the module.
- Open any supported document (e.g. a Sales Order).
- Click Direct Print in the header or gear menu, or Print Labels on a product form.
- Your browser's print dialog opens â select your printer and print!
Configuration
To make any Odoo report use Direct Print by default:
- Go to Settings â Technical â Reports.
- Open the report you want to modify.
- Enable the Use Direct Print checkbox.
From now on, clicking that report will open the browser print dialog instead of downloading a PDF.
Please log in to comment on this module